Don Lopp 12 Nov 2000: 
>I am at a loss to understand how one can successfully 
>utilize a 7 ft window with M F stereo. Depth of focus 
>requires at least f 32 or f 45 ...

Not all pictures need reaching to infinity, in fact
the best part of normal (about 65 mm) base stereopictures
is often between 7 and 10 feet (2 to 3 m).
When depth of field is restricted, it is better to cut
at the far end of the scene than at the near end, in
my opinion. At infinity there is no stereoperception...
(Not specific for MF.)
